Responsibilities

The Senior Quantitative Scientist will be a hands-on individual contributor, writing readable code for analyses leveraging observational data to generate real-world evidence, and serving as the technical lead in driving initiatives fundamental to the team’s infrastructure best practices. They will also collaborate cross-functionally with various teams to translate clinical investigation questions into detailed data analytics requirements, work on commercial retrospective clinical studies leveraging EHR real-world data, and influence investment decisions to enable scalable technical processes.

About Verana Health

Verana Health assembles and analyzes large-scale clinical databases to support physicians and enhance medical research. By partnering with medical associations, the company creates regulatory-grade data platforms that generate valuable medical evidence and insights. These platforms serve life science companies and healthcare providers, offering them data that improves evidence generation and patient outcomes. Verana Health focuses on big data, analytics, and artificial intelligence to provide actionable insights that help life science companies accelerate research, identify trial patients, and understand patient experiences better. The company earns revenue through partnerships and data services offered to its clients.

Differentiation

Verana Health manages data from over 20,000 providers and 70 EHR systems.
Their VeraQ™ engine enhances data integrity with AI and clinician direction.
Exclusive partnerships with specialty medical societies provide unique, regulatory-grade data platforms.
